PyeongChang 2018 hosts 2nd Paralympic Day event
SEOUL, March 9, 2016 – The PyeongChang Organizing Committee for the 2018 Olympic and Paralympic Winter Games (POCOG) has celebrated its ‘2nd Paralympic Day’ at the Uiam Ice Rink in Chuncheon, capital city of Gangwon Province on March 9th, 2016.
 
‘Paralympic Day’ is part of PyeongChang’s promotions to enhance the awareness and perception of para-sports in Korea.  POCOG President Yang-Ho Cho, Governor of Gangwon Province CHOI Moon-soon, Korean Paralympic Committee (KPC) President KIM Sung-il, International Paralympic Committee (IPC) Governing Board member NA Kyung-won, PyeongChang 2018 Ambassador KIM Yuna, and other officials from the sports industry attended the event to celebrate 2-years-to-go to the PyeongChang 2018 Paralympic Winter Games.
